Answer:
17.96m/s
Step-by-step explanation:
Based on law of conservation of momentum;
m1u1 +m2u2 =(m1+m2)v
v is the velocities of the car after impact
Substitute the given values
1300(20)+900(15) = (1300+900)v
26000 + 13500 = 2200v
39500 = 2200v
v = 39500/2200
v = 17.96m/s
Hence the speed of the cars after impact is 17.96m/s
